[發明專利]一種通過SPI接口讀取IIC存儲卡的方法無效
| 申請號: | 200910230992.6 | 申請日: | 2009-11-27 |
| 公開(公告)號: | CN101719053A | 公開(公告)日: | 2010-06-02 |
| 發明(設計)人: | 曹瑩瑩 | 申請(專利權)人: | 曹瑩瑩 |
| 主分類號: | G06F3/08 | 分類號: | G06F3/08;G06K7/00 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 250014 山*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 通過 spi 接口 讀取 iic 存儲 方法 | ||
技術領域
本發明涉及一種稅控設備技術領域,具體地說是一種通過SPI接口讀取IIC存儲卡的方法。
背景技術
目前讀卡器多數以串口或USB作為接口與其它設備通信。
在系統中,串口資源有限,但是使用非常頻繁,很多器件和外設使用串口和設備通信,這就造成了串口資源的緊缺。頻繁的切換串口設備不但容易造成接口的損壞而且影響的開發或使用的效率。
USB接口在若干中、高檔MCU中沒有集成,如果想實現USB通信需要加USB芯片,而且,在系統內部,MCU和其它元器件的通信很少采用USB通信。
另外,部分MCU沒有IIC通信接口,其GPIO也不能設置成輸入輸出的雙向傳輸模式,不能模擬IIC通信,因此不能直接操作IIC接口的元器件。
發明內容
本發明的目的是提供一種通過SPI接口讀取IIC存儲卡的方法。
本發明的一種通過SPI接口讀取IIC存儲卡的方法,是按以下方式實現的,硬件結構是由電源、晶振、LED指示燈、SPI接口、處理器MCU和IIC接口存儲卡讀卡器組成,電源、晶振、LED指示燈、SPI接口和IIC接口存儲卡讀卡器通過數據線與處理器MCU連接,利用SPI接口與的處理器MCU通信,實現對IIC接口存儲卡讀卡器的操作,讀取步驟如下:
將IIC接口存儲卡讀卡器設置為SPI從機,處理器MCU設置為SPI主機,IIC接口存儲卡讀卡器通過SPI總線連接到處理器MCU,實現SPI通信,處理器MCU的功能是通過SPI接口與設備的處理器MCU通信接口連接,接收處理器MCU發送的數據,并按照事先約定好的格式解析出操作IC卡的命令和參數,然后轉換成IIC的協議格式對IIC接口上的存儲卡進行相應的操作。
處理器MCU通過自帶的SPI接口和IIC接口實現與SPI通信和IIC通信,或通過GPIO模擬SPI接口或IIC接口實現與SPI通信或IIC通信。
LED是讀卡器工作指示燈,當讀卡器工作時,LED發光以方便生產和維護。
本發明的優異效果是:克服了現有技術存在的不足,開發一種既能外置又能內置的SPI接口的讀寫IIC存儲卡的讀卡器,以節省串口資源,解決接口不匹配的問題。
附圖說明
圖1是讀卡器的電路原理圖。
具體實施方式:
下面結合附圖和具體實施方式對本發明做進一步說明:
本發明的一種通過SPI接口讀取IIC存儲卡的方法,如附圖1所示,硬件是由電源,晶振,LED指示燈,SPI接口,處理器和IIC接口存儲卡讀卡器組成。所述讀卡器利用SPI接口與設備的MCU通信接口連接,實現對IC卡的操作。讀卡器設置為SPI從機,所述設備的MCU設置為SPI主機,讀卡器通過SPI總線連接到設備的MCU,實現SPI通信。
處理器為中檔或低檔MCU,可以通過自帶的SPI接口和IIC接口實現SPI通信和IIC通信,或可以通過GPIO模擬SPI接口或IIC接口實現SPI通信或IIC通信。處理器的功能是通過SPI接口與設備的MCU通信,接收MCU發送的數據,并按照事先約定好的格式解析出操作IC卡的命令和參數,然后轉換成IIC的協議格式對IIC接口上的存儲卡進行相應的操作。
處理器MCU通過自帶的SPI接口和IIC接口實現與SPI通信和IIC通信,或通過GPIO模擬SPI接口或IIC接口實現與SPI通信或IIC通信。
LED是讀卡器工作指示燈,當讀卡器工作時,LED發光以方便生產和維護。
實施例
本發明的讀卡器是由電源,晶振,LED指示燈,SPI接口,處理器和IIC接口存儲卡讀卡器組成。
本發明的典型的實施方式是系統內置。圖中的SPI接口直接與MCU的SPI接口連接,可實現單主機多從機通信和單主機單從機通信。當配置為單主機單從機通信時SPI的CS可以省略不接。當采用外置方式時,系統要預留SPI接口。
處理器接收到SPI主機發送的數據后,根據和主機約定好的數據格式解析命令和參數,所以,要求在開發MCU的程序時,要與讀卡器配合進行。另外,SPI和IIC的基本通信協議都比較簡單,這里就不再贅述了。
本讀卡器利用中、低檔MCU作為處理器,實現了SPI協議和IIC協議的轉換,解決了接口不匹配的問題,節省了串口資源,具有成本低,可移植性強的優點。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于曹瑩瑩,未經曹瑩瑩許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200910230992.6/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:起重機轉場輔助裝置、運輸拖車及拆裝起重機的方法
- 下一篇:稻殼輸送裝置





